Flat roof replacement services involve removing an existing flat roofing system and installing a new, durable surface to protect the underlying structure. This process typically includes inspecting the current roof, removing damaged or aging materials, repairing any underlying issues, and applying a new roofing membrane suited for flat roofs. The goal is to provide a long-lasting, weather-resistant surface that can withstand the elements and prevent leaks or structural damage over time.
One of the primary issues that flat roof replacement services address is persistent leaks or water infiltration. Over time, flat roofs can develop cracks, blisters, or areas of ponding water, which compromise their integrity. Replacing a failing roof can help eliminate ongoing leaks, reduce the risk of water damage to the building’s interior, and improve overall energy efficiency by ensuring proper insulation and sealing. This service is essential for maintaining the safety and functionality of the property, especially in regions with heavy rainfall or snow.

Professionals offering flat roof replacement services utilize a variety of roofing materials, including built-up roofing (BUR), modified bitumen, single-ply membranes such as TPO or EPDM, and spray-applied roofing systems. The choice of material depends on the property’s specific needs, budget, and environmental exposure. Cost Range - Flat roof replacement services typically cost between $5,000 and $15,000, depending on the size and materials used. For example, a standard residential flat roof might fall around $8,000 to $12,000. Costs can vary based on project scope and local labor rates.
Material Expenses - The choice of roofing material influences overall costs, with options like EPDM rubber costing approximately $4 to $8 per square foot. TPO and PVC membranes may range from $5 to $10 per square foot, impacting the total project price. Material costs are a key factor in the final estimate.
Labor Costs - Labor for flat roof replacement generally accounts for 50% to 60% of the total project cost. In Somers, CT, labor charges might range from $2,500 to $6,000 for an average-sized roof. The complexity of the roof and local rates can influence labor expenses.
Additional Expenses - Extra costs may include roof decking repairs, flashing replacement, or insulation upgrades, which can add several hundred to a few thousand dollars. For instance, minor repairs could be around $500, while extensive work might reach $2,000 or more. These additional services can affect the overall budget.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What are the signs that a flat roof needs replacement? Indicators include persistent leaks, extensive membrane damage, visible cracks or blisters, and widespread ponding water that cannot drain properly.
How long does a flat roof replacement typically take? The duration varies based on the size and complexity of the roof, but most replacements are completed within a few days by local contractors.
What materials are commonly used for flat roof replacements? Common options include built-up roofing (BUR), modified bitumen, and single-ply membranes like TPO or PVC, selected based on the specific needs of the building.
